On this Thanksgiving Eve episode, I open the phones for a lively, sometimes feisty, community conversation about gratitude, freedom, and practical ways to get ahead of debt. We talk mortgage strategy (including first‑lien HELOCs, paycheck parking, and simple prepayment tactics), why understanding amortization matters, and how to respond to scary‑sounding letters from revenue agencies. We also revisit the difference between federal citizenship and living privately, and why numbers, organization, and courage—not fear—move the needle. We range across current geopolitics (Venezuela, Cuba, the Monroe Doctrine), election integrity concerns and Executive Order 13848, and the cultural moment as we head into the holiday. Listeners share wins, questions, and a powerful testimony about stepping out of the system and back into faith. Programming note: no trust class tonight; we’ll be back Friday with Brent.
